Eles te vendem a ideia de que criar uma interface é fácil. Um clique aqui, um ajuste ali, e pronto: um aplicativo que parece ter saído de um anúncio de corporação. Uma mentira bem contada, digna dos mestres da manipulação digital. A verdade é que a UI, essa coisa que você usa todos os dias sem pensar, é um campo de batalha invisível. E nós, os desenvolvedores, somos os soldados esquecidos nesse conflito de pixels e decisões.

Pensa comigo: você é chamado para criar uma tela. 'Ah, isso é simples', você pensa. Você coloca um botão, um campo de texto, talvez uma imagem. Bonito, né? Mas aí vem a dor. O espaçamento. Aquele maldito 'espaço em branco' que parece insignificante, mas que dita o ritmo, a clareza, a própria respiração da sua interface. Uma margem errada e tudo parece apertado, sufocante. Uma linha de espaço a mais e a hierarquia visual desmorona, jogando o usuário em um labirinto de informações sem sentido.

A Guerra do Espaçamento

O espaço em branco não é vazio. É informação. É respiro. É o silêncio que permite que as palavras falem. Corporações adoram preencher cada centímetro quadrado com 'conteúdo', com 'chamadas para ação', com mais anúncios. Por quê? Controle. Se tudo é urgente, nada é. A UI corporativa é projetada para te sobrecarregar, para te manter preso, para te fazer clicar no próximo link patrocinado.

Mas quando você tenta fazer certo, quando busca a clareza, a harmonia, você percebe que cada milímetro conta. A distância entre um título e um parágrafo. O alinhamento perfeito de elementos. A consistência nas margens. São decisões pequenas, que levam tempo, que exigem atenção, que te fazem questionar a sanidade. E no fim, o usuário não percebe o esforço. Ele só sente que 'funciona bem'. E essa é a verdadeira vitória: a invisibilidade do bom design.

Hierarquia Visual: O Mapa da Mina

E a hierarquia visual? Outro pesadelo disfarçado de simplicidade. O que deve chamar a atenção primeiro? O que é secundário? O que é apenas detalhe? Não é só colocar o título maior. É sobre peso, cor, contraste, posição. É guiar o olhar do usuário como um maestro rege uma orquestra. Sem isso, o usuário se perde. Ele olha para a tela e não sabe por onde começar, o que é importante, o que ele deve fazer. É como entregar um mapa sem legendas em uma cidade desconhecida.

As big techs sabem disso. Elas usam a hierarquia visual para te empurrar para onde elas querem. O botão de 'comprar' em destaque, o link de 'cancelar assinatura' escondido em um cinza pálido. É manipulação disfarçada de design. E nós, os criadores, ficamos presos entre a necessidade de fazer algo que funcione e a pressão para implementar as ordens corporativas que visam apenas o lucro, não a experiência humana.

Pequenas Decisões, Grandes Impactos

Cada escolha de cor, cada curva de um botão, cada tipo de fonte utilizada. Tudo isso carrega um peso. Uma fonte serifada pode evocar tradição, mas em telas pequenas pode ser ilegível. Uma fonte sem serifa é moderna, limpa, mas pode parecer fria demais. A cor azul pode transmitir confiança, mas um tom errado pode parecer genérico ou até alarmante. E a acessibilidade? Isso nem sempre entra na conta inicial, mas deveria ser a base de tudo. O contraste de cores para daltônicos, o tamanho da fonte para idosos, a navegação para quem usa leitores de tela. São as pequenas decisões que transformam uma interface usável em uma interface inclusiva, ou em uma barreira intransponível.

Então, da próxima vez que você olhar para um aplicativo e pensar 'nossa, como isso é simples e bonito', lembre-se da guerra silenciosa que aconteceu ali. Lembre-se dos desenvolvedores que lutaram contra a complexidade, contra a pressão corporativa, contra a própria natureza traiçoeira do design de interface, para entregar algo que, na sua simplicidade aparente, esconde uma complexidade brutal. A UI não é simples. É uma ilusão. E nós, os rebeldes do código, somos os que pagamos o preço para manter essa ilusão funcionando, na esperança de que, um dia, a liberdade e a clareza vençam a manipulação.